Abstract

Indonesian has a very rich, unique, and priceless biodiversity and natural resources. Featuring this national treasure is the aim of this research, especially the fauna and flora endemic to Sumatra Island. This research is executed through descriptive qualitative method by exploration and literature study for the first stage and design implementation for the second stage. The first stage contains exploration on Sumatran flora and fauna, batik motifs, contemporary textile design, color composition and trend. The finding of the research is presented at the second stage through contemporary textile motif as the design implementation that can be applied to fashion products. Expectantly, this research can provide guideline and inspiration for textile and fashion designers in developing contemporary textile motifs that take inspirations from the nature and culture of Indonesia.
